Nginx

Pick nginx when you need a battle-tested reverse proxy or static-file server in front of a monolith or a handful of services and you're fine hand-writing config — its epoll-based core still edges out Caddy and Traefik on raw static-file throughput in most 2026 third-party benchmarks

Pros

  • +Don't pick it for Kubernetes-native microservices with rotating pod IPs — Traefik's CRD-based service discovery beats hand-reloading nginx configs on every deploy
